Dallas Activities and Sites

Visiting Dallas is a great way to spend your vacation or
for a weekend get-away. The state of Texas is amazing in
its own right but tourists have proven that Dallas is the
most visited city in Texas. Dallas is situated on the
Trinity River and has many creeks and small tributaries
that branch off into the city. You can take a walk along
the Trinity and enjoy the many trees that line the path,
including oak trees, cottonwood trees, and pecan trees.

The southwestern United States thrives on the financial and
business center that makes up Dallas. There are always
conventions for businesses and groups to attend. In fact,
Dallas refers to itself as the busiest convention city in
North America. If you are spending a night or more, you'll
have a variety of hotels to choose from. You can luxuriate
in a gorgeous suite, or if you want to save money, you can
find excellent budget accommodations. You can stay in the
heart of the city or retreat to the quieter suburbs or stay
out near the airport.

Dallas may be a big financial city but this doesn~t mean
that you won~t find a great amount of culture and art here
as well. There are many museums and art galleries that you
can visit during your stay in Dallas. One of the more
prominent museums that is a must see is the African
American Museum that is located at Fair Park. A walk
through this museum will keep you busy as you look at the
many displays and exhibits, which feature a huge collection
of African folk art and contemporary art. You~ll walk away
with a better understanding of African American heritage
and culture.

Children are sure to find the Dallas Children's Museum
exciting and interactive. With hands-on activities, children
play life-like scenarios such as a farm, hospital, grocery
store and firehouse. Lots of fun and great play in a
learning situation.

No trip to Dallas would be complete without a little
shopping. Dallas is home to a variety of boutiques and even
some second-hand shops that sell the wares of top- rated
designers such as Armani, Donna Karan, and Emanuael. Dallas
is also home to many a sports enthusiast - with professional
basketball, baseball, football and hockey. Or, if you want
to participate in sports, you'll find lots of challenging
golf courses. After 18-holes of golf, you can retire to one
of the many fine Dallas restaurants.

Regardless of what time of the year you visit Dallas, you'll
find something fun to do and leave with a desire to comeback
for more.
